Transaction 33ae128e106c9f73633458eb31e9f2154d33d476a18f044497741ceb2dab7260
1 Input
2 Outputs
- 33ae128e106c9f73633458eb31e9f2154d33d476a18f044497741ceb2dab7260:0
- 33ae128e106c9f73633458eb31e9f2154d33d476a18f044497741ceb2dab7260:1
value 165516
address 3KHT8fHEoJaTKxxWLA2RsS9Tprc94cq6NK
value 331610
address 1MtLvfXf9fRpNUKWEYWYVnc53Pgcm2TmTP